About Gelin Dahua

Company Overview

Gelin Dahua is a Chinese futures company headquartered in Beijing's CBD at 2501, 29/F (actual 25/F), Building 8, Jianguomenwai Street, Chaoyang District. It was founded on August 16, 2018, and operates as a wholly owned subsidiary of Shanxi Securities Co., Ltd. The company traces its roots to Greenwood Futures Co., Ltd., established in 1993 as one of China's earliest futures companies, giving it a long-standing industry heritage.

According to its public records, Gelin Dahua is approved by the China Securities Regulatory Commission (CSRC) and holds a derivatives trading license from the China Financial Futures Exchange (CFFEX). The CFFEX license is listed as regulated, though no further details on scope or tier are available from aggregated industry data.

Regulation and Licensing

Gelin Dahua's primary regulator is the China Financial Futures Exchange (CFFEX), under a Derivatives Trading License (AGN) with status 'Regulated' in China. This license authorizes the firm to engage in futures and derivatives trading within the Chinese market. However, as a domestic entity focused on Chinese futures, it is not regulated by major international bodies such as the FCA or CySEC.

Our review cross-checked the license against public registers, confirming its active status. Traders outside China should note that the broker operates under Chinese financial regulations, which may differ significantly from those in other jurisdictions.

Target Audience

Gelin Dahua targets Chinese domestic traders and institutions interested in regulated futures markets. Given its history and backing by Shanxi Securities, it is positioned as a traditional, established player in China's futures industry. The company does not appear to market to retail forex or CFD traders outside China.

For traders seeking offshore or international brokerage services, Gelin Dahua may not be a suitable option due to its China-centric regulatory and product focus.
